public ChainResponsePolicy::check(Response $response, Request $request)
Determines whether it is save to store a page in the cache.
Parameters
\Symfony\Component\HttpFoundation\Response $response: The response which is about to be sent to the client.
\Symfony\Component\HttpFoundation\Request $request: The request object.
Return value
string|null Either static::DENY or NULL. Calling code may attempt to store a page in the cache unless static::DENY is returned. Returns NULL if the policy policy is not specified for the given response.
Overrides ResponsePolicyInterface::check

Code
public function check(Response $response, Request $request) {
  foreach ($this->rules as $rule) {
    $result = $rule->check($response, $request);
    if ($result === static::DENY) {
      return $result;
    }
    elseif (isset($result)) {
      throw new \UnexpectedValueException('Return value of ResponsePolicyInterface::check() must be one of ResponsePolicyInterface::DENY or NULL');
    }
  }
}
